Abstract
Diabetic retinopathy (DR) is the leading cause of blindness among working-age adults in the US We aimed to assess relationships between social determinants of health and indicators of DR severity at initial presentation at a public safety net hospital.
We conducted a cross-sectional study using electronic health records among patients presenting to Zuckerberg San Francisco General (ZSFG) with diabetic retinopathy. Outcomes included DR severity (non-proliferative vs proliferative) and visual acuity (VA) at initial presentation. Multivariable modified Poisson and linear regressions were used to assess the relationship between sociodemographic and clinical predictors and these outcomes.
We identified 2044 patients with DR at initial presentation to (1851 with complete VA data) who had a mean (SD) age was 55.8 (11.6) years. Two hundred eighty (13.7%) patients had proliferative DR at initial presentation to ZSFG and 449 (24.3%) had some level of visual impairment or blindness (logMAR ≥ 0.30). Predictors increasing the risk of severe DR included experiencing housing or economic problems (adjusted Risk Ratio (aRR) 1.35, 95% CI 1.0 to 1.71, P=0.01), other race and ethnicity (aRR 1.94, 95% CI 1.06 to 3.54, p=0.03), former smoking status (aRR 1.28, 95% CI 1.00 to 1.64, P=0.05). Predictors associated with worse visual acuity at presentation included Medicare (adjusted Mean Difference (aMD) 0.05 logMAR, 95% CI 0.01 to 0.10) and Medicaid (aMD 0.06 logMAR, 95% CI 0.01 to 0.10, P =0.01) insurance status, hypertension (aMD 0.03 logMAR, 95% CI 0.002 to 0.06, P =0.04), age (aMD 0.02 logMAR, 95% CI 0.00 to 0.03, p=0.01), and Cantonese language (aMD 0.04 logMAR, 95% CI 0.00 to 0.09, p=0.05).
Given the high burden of severe DR and vision loss in this population, identifying approaches to target high-risk groups with early diagnosis and treatment among vulnerable populations is needed.
